Book Descriptions
for The Secret Library by Kekla Magoon
From Cooperative Children's Book Center (CCBC)
Biracial Dally, 11, lives on the family estate with her mom (white), who runs the family business and is already training Dally to take over. Dally hates her mom’s workaholic ways and demanding expectations. Dally’s dad (Black) died years before. More recently, Dally lost her beloved maternal grandfather. When Dally discovers The Secret Library, it’s clear the mysterious librarian, Jennacake, knows who Dally is. Jennacake explains the library rules: only secrets to which Dally has a connection will reveal themselves to her, and she can read just one a day. Each secret transports Dally back to the place and time of its origins. She witnesses her mom and dad’s early romance, when a failed dare led to love that transcended racial and economic differences. And she repeatedly finds herself with the crew of an 1850s pirate ship. It becomes clear that the captain, Eli (white), and first mate, Pete (Black), are life partners, a secret it would be dangerous to reveal, and that they created the treasure map that Dally’s Grandpa cherished. It’s also on the ship that she meets Jack, another crew member and, she later discovers, another time traveler. Jack’s connection to Dally is a welcome surprise, but one that reveals another unsettling truth about race and racism in the past. Dally’s discoveries bring clarity to her family history and identity, as well as her mother’s grief, while setting her on a surprising yet seemingly destined course in this captivating tale.

From the Publisher
An instant New York Times bestseller!
Travel through time with National Book Award Finalist Kekla Magoon in a page-turning fantasy adventure about family secrets and finding the courage to plot your own life story.
Since Grandpa died, Dally's days are dull and restricted. She's eleven and a half years old, and her exacting single mother is already preparing her to take over the family business. Starved for adventure and release, Dally rescues a mysterious envelope from her mother's clutches, an envelope Grandpa had earmarked for her. The map she finds inside leads straight to an ancient vault, a library of secrets where each book is a portal to a precise moment in time. As Dally "checks out" adventure after adventure--including an exhilarating outing with pirates--she begins to dive deep into her family's hidden history. Soon she's visiting every day to escape the demands of the present. But the library has secrets of its own, intentions that would shape her life as surely as her mother's meticulous plans. What will Dally choose? Equal parts mystery and adventure--with a biracial child puzzling out her identity alongside the legacy of the past--this masterful middle-grade fantasy rivets with crackling prose, playful plot twists, and timeless themes. A satisfying choice for fans of Kindred and When You Reach Me.
